NEWS
Test Adapter Linux Control v1.x.x
-
@liv-in-sky sagte in Test Adapter Linux Control v0.x.x:
@Wal ich denke das geht schon
Da muß ich mal testen
-
@Wal und ich werd mir deinen mal ansehen - ist total an mir vorbei gegangen
-
@Wal wichtig ist, dass der befehl als button definiert wird
-
@liv-in-sky
hmm, was gebe ich als Abrufintervall ein, ich will ja nicht pollen ? -
@Wal verstehe ich nicht ganz
das interval wird gebraucht für z.b folder abfragen oder service abfragen
wenn du nur einen button für einen server einrichten willst - also ohne folder oder service - wird das im moment nicht funktioneren
wenn du die datenpunkte (tab DATENPUNKTE) alle deaktivierst, weiß ich nicht ob noch gepollt wird und ob noch die befehle ausgeführt werden - mußt du ausprobieren
im log siehst du, ob gepollt wird -
@liv-in-sky sagte in Test Adapter Linux Control v0.x.x:
@Wal verstehe ich nicht ganz
das interval wird gebraucht für z.b folder abfragen oder service abfragen
wenn du nur einen button für einen server einrichten willst - also ohne folder oder service - wird das im moment nicht funktioneren
wenn du die datenpunkte (tab DATENPUNKTE) alle deaktivierst, weiß ich nicht ob noch gepollt wird und ob noch die befehle ausgeführt werden - mußt du ausprobieren
im log siehst du, ob gepollt wirdHab alles deaktiviert und den Intervall auf 9999 gestellt, funktioniert, danke.
-
@Wal sagte in Test Adapter Linux Control v0.x.x:
Hab alles deaktiviert und den Intervall auf 9999 gestellt, funktioniert, danke.
Ich bau noch ein, das bei Intervall = 0 das polling deaktiviert wird.
Alternativ kann man auch den Adapter einmal nach der Konfirguration eines eigenen Button laufen lassen und dann den host deaktiviert setzen (bei aktiviert den haken raus)@Homoran sagte in Test Adapter Linux Control v0.x.x:
@Scrounger sagte in Test Adapter Linux Control v0.x.x:
@Homoran
Hab noch was eingebaut, bitte teste mal die aktuelle github versionHabe neu installiert - upload gemacht und Instanz sicherheitshalber nochmal gestartet.
steht immer noch
null
drinHab nochmal was eingebaut, bitte teste die aktuelle version von github.
Dein Tinker hat keine berechtigung:2020-08-15 16:08:27.315 - debug: linux-control.0 (19029) [folderSizes] Tinker (192.168.138.74:22): response stdout: Sorry, user pi is not allowed to execute '/usr/bin/find /opt/iobroker/iobroker-data -name * -type f -exec stat -c %Y %n -- {} ;' as root on localhost.
-
-
ist mir gerade in den sinn gekommen
könnte man da was über das sudoers file auf dem tinker machen ?
-
@liv-in-sky müsste mich mal schlau machen wo es steht, aber irgendwo konnte man einstellen ob bei sudo das Passwort abgefragt werden soll.
Das wollte ich aber eigentlich nicht ändern, im Gegenteil beim RaspiOS stört mich die fehlende Abfrage. -
@Homoran oder du gehst ohne passwort über rsa key file
-
@liv-in-sky Vielleicht geht auch was mit dem
sticky bit.
[Edit:] Ich meinte natürlich setuid, nicht sticky bit. -
@Scrounger
habe gestern abend mal versucht, eine verbindung über rsa key file zu erstellen. anschliessend habe ich den pfad wieder aus dem setting im adapter genommen um wieder mit passwort zu verbinden - seitdem habe ich fehler und die verbindung wird nicht wieder hergestellt - iobroker restart heute morgen brachte keine verbesserunglinux-control.0 2020-08-17 08:29:10.256 error (2065) [getConnection] error: config.privateKey does not exist at given fs path, stack: AssertionError [ERR_ASSERTION]: config.privateKey does not exist at given fs path at new AssertionError (int linux-control.0 2020-08-17 08:29:10.255 error (2065) [getConnection] Could not establish a connection to 'Proxmox' (192.168.178.10:22)! linux-control.0 2020-08-17 08:28:10.247 error (2065) [getConnection] error: config.privateKey does not exist at given fs path, stack: AssertionError [ERR_ASSERTION]: config.privateKey does not exist at given fs path at new AssertionError (int linux-control.0 2020-08-17 08:28:10.246 error (2065) [getConnection] Could not establish a connection to 'Proxmox' (192.168.178.10:22)! linux-control.0 2020-08-17 08:27:10.236 error (2065) [getConnection] error: config.privateKey does not exist at given fs path, stack: AssertionError [ERR_ASSERTION]: config.privateKey does not exist at given fs path at new AssertionError (int linux-control.0 2020-08-17 08:27:10.236 error (2065) [getConnection] Could not establish a connection to 'Proxmox' (192.168.178.10:22)!
hast du eine idee dazu ?
-
@liv-in-sky sagte in Test Adapter Linux Control v0.x.x:
hast du eine idee dazu ?
Ja da muss ich noch was abfangen. Werd im Laufe des Tages noch eine neue Version bauen.
-
@Scrounger danke und gruß
-
@liv-in-sky
So neue Version 0.2.7 ist auf github.@Homoran
Bitte die auch nochmal testen, hab da noch was eingebaut, was deinen fehler hoffentlich jetzt löst. -
@Scrounger 0.2.7 läuft hier, keine Auffälligkeiten.
-
@Scrounger sagte in Test Adapter Linux Control v0.x.x:
@Homoran
Bitte die auch nochmal testen,Bin nicht am PC, nur mit Handy upgedatet.
nuc vm hat jetzt werte, tinker nicht.muss mal später vom PC den debug Modus aktivieren und das log rauslassen
-
ich kann nun einen rsa key eingeben und das password löschen - dann connectet er über rsa. setze ich einen rsa key mit falschen pfad kommt fehler - anschliessend gebe ich das password wieder ein und er verbindet sich wieder - problem gelöst
danke
-
frage - denkst du es wäre möglich, wenn ein befehl (button) ausgeführt wird, das man dann die datenpunkte des betreffenden servers aktualisieren (poll) könnte ?
momentan , wenn der server alle 5 minuten abgefragt wird, wird das ergebnis ( z.b service ist gestoppt) erst (wenn es dumm läuft) nach 5 minuten im dp gezeigt